It can be due to gastritis or gall bladder related problem. In case of gastritis applying warm water bag will give you relief. You can also take proton pump inhibitors like esomeprazole (Nexium) once daily before break fast. Taking antacid syrups like gaviscon also helps. Better to get an ECG (ekg) to rule out cardiac related pain to be on safe side.
If there is no improvement then ultrasound examination of abdomen should be done to rule out gall bladder problems and to know the exact status.
